What is a Good Game to Play With a Large Group?

A good game to play with a large group is Charades. It is a classic party game that can be enjoyed by people of all ages. The object of the game is to act out a word or phrase without speaking, and have your teammates guess what it is you are trying to say.

Charades is great for large groups because it can be played with as many people as you want – there is no limit! It’s also a very versatile game, as it can be tailored to suit any age group or interests. For example, you could make up charades words and phrases that relate to pop culture, current events, inside jokes, etc.

If you’re looking for a fun and interactive way to entertain a large group of people, Charades is definitely the way to go!

What Games Can You Play With 20 People?

There are a lot of games that can be played with 20 people. Here are some examples: -Charades: This classic game is a great way to get everyone involved and laughing.

All you need is a group of people and someone to act out words or phrases while the others guess. -Pictionary: Similar to charades, but with drawing instead of acting. One person draws a picture based on a word or phrase while the others guess what it is.

-Trivia: Gather a group of friends together and see who knows the most random facts! You can make your own trivia questions or use ones from a trivia book or online quiz. -Scavenger Hunt: This is a great game for larger groups.

Divide everyone into teams and send them off to find specific items on a list. The first team back with all the items wins!
